What is Outbound Marketing?
Outbound Marketing involves proactively reaching out to potential customers through channels like cold emails, calls, and advertising to generate interest and leads.

Full Definition
This traditional marketing approach contrasts with inbound tactics by initiating contact rather than waiting for customer engagement.
Common outbound methods include telemarketing, direct mail, cold outreach emails, and paid ads.
Effective outbound marketing requires targeted lists, compelling messaging, and follow-up strategies to convert leads.
